Question about timing belt tools

Has anyone used this?
http://cgi.ebay.com/ebaymotors/ws/eBayISAPI.dll?ViewItem&category=43993&item=2440366047

I want to replace my timing/balance belt, all rollers/seals, and the water pump. I know that there's a lot of controversy about the Kriket, but I'm mainly wondering about the other tool. Has anyone used that balance bolt/sprocket wrench? Does it do what it claims to do without making the job much tougher than if I had the other two tools? Are these the only special tools that I'll need (I have a basic wrench/socket set and I can buy other basic needed things from a local Sears)?

Thanks for those kind words guys. Swim, you might consider a flywheel lock or some way to hold the crank enough to remove the crankshaft bolt (~ 160 ft/lbs).
